TrekUk wrote: educate me then?

Dario Pegoretti is a small Italian artisan builder, he makes steel, stainless steel and alum frames. He has a small range of models. Mine is a Marcelo (or MxxxxxO), his "main" model. The paint is his Ciavete or "Dario's choice" and can be shock to some.

A search will give you more info.
